Upper:
Vltor MUR-1A
Del-ton 16" chromed lined M4 barrel
Troy MRF-R 12" rail
Midwest Industries LP gas block
Badger Ordnance full ambi charging handle
Primary Weapons FCS556
SWI nickel BCG

Lower:
AXTS AX556
Magpul UBR
Wilson Combat TTU stage 1 trigger
CAA grip
Battle Arms ambi safety

Accessories:
EOTech HHS I
Mako Group(FAB Defense) G2 T-Pod
3ea Lancer L5 AWM 30rd magazines
3ea Magpul M2/M3 Pmags 30rd magazines
Ergo rail ladder covers
Plano 42" gun guard case
